Ansicht
Dokumentation

/SAPAPO/OM_TS_OBJECTS_CLEAN - Prüft, repariert oder löscht Objekte abhängig vom Modus

/SAPAPO/OM_TS_OBJECTS_CLEAN - Prüft, repariert oder löscht Objekte abhängig vom Modus

General Data in Customer Master   ABAP Short Reference  
Diese Dokumentation steht unter dem Copyright der SAP AG.
SAP E-Book

Funktionalität

Dieser Funktionsbaustein löst eine Prüfung der strukturellen Konsistenz von Objekten im liveCache aus. Wenn die Tabelle der prüfenden Objekte IT_TS_OBJECT_KEY leer ist, werden der Reihe nach alle Zeitraster, Patterns, Patternketten, Zeitverschiebungen, Kennzahlen und Zeitreihen der betreffenden Planversion geprüft. Anderenfalls werden genau die in dieser Tabelle angegebenen Objekte behandelt.

Der Parameter IV_MODE legt fest, in welchem Modus der Funktionsbaustein arbeitet:

  • "P" - Prüfmodus: Die strukturelle Konsistenz wird nur geprüft, gefundene Inkonsistenzen werden zurückgeliefert jedoch keine Änderung an den Prüfobjekten vorgenommen.
  • "R" - Reparaturmodus: Werden Inkonsistenzen gefunden, erfolgt ein Reparaturversuch. Je nach Art der gefundenen Inkonsistenz kann dies zur Modifikation oder zum Löschen der Prüfobjekte im liveCache führen.
  • "D" - Löschmodus: Die in Tabelle IT_TS_OBJECT_KEY aufgeführten Objekte werden aus dem livCache gelöscht. Der Aufruf mit einer leeren Objekttabelle ist in diesem Modus nicht möglich.

Die Tabellen ET_TS_OBJECT_KEY und ET_RELATION_KEYS beinhalten die gefundenen bzw. reparierten Objekte und Relationen.

Datailinformationen zu den gefundenen Inkonsistenzen werden in der optionalen Tabelle CT_CLEAN_INFO zur Verfügung gestellt.

Beispiel

Hinweise

Dieser Funktionsbaustein untersucht nur Korrektheit der liveCache-Objekte selbst. Es wird keine Prüfung der Daten vorgenommen, die in diesen Objekten gespeichert sind. Eine Reparatur zieht ggf. auch logische Inkonsistenzen nach sich. Derartige Inkonsistenzen können mit dem Funktionsbaustein /SAPAPO/OM_TS_OBJECTS_CHECK gefunden und repariert werden.

Weiterführende Informationen





Parameter

CT_CLEAN_INFO
ET_RC
ET_RELATION_KEYS
ET_TS_OBJECT_KEY
IS_GEN_PARAMS
IT_TS_OBJECT_KEY
IV_LCNAME
IV_MODE

Ausnahmen

LC_APPL_ERROR
LC_COM_ERROR
LC_CONNECT_FAILED

Funktionsgruppe

APO/SAPLOM_TIMESERIES

ROGBILLS - Synchronize billing plans   CL_GUI_FRONTEND_SERVICES - Frontend Services  
Diese Dokumentation steht unter dem Copyright der SAP AG.

Length: 2443 Date: 20240426 Time: 234100     sap01-206 ( 55 ms )